Burnside is seeking enthusiastic individuals to join our Field Services team as Field Services Representatives (Junior Construction Inspectors).
Who Were Looking For:
We seek adaptable individuals who thrive in an everevolving environment. Our ideal candidate is someone who excels in learning on the go values fairness fosters strong working relationships with all parties involved maintains meticulous notes and consistently goes the extra mile to ensure topnotch service delivery to our clients during all stages of projects from start of construction to municipal assumption.
The Role:
As part of our team youll work with your manager in coordinating daily projects conducting full time periodic and / or resident inspections to ensure projects align with drawings and specifications. Your role will involve liaising between owners clients contractors and various project stakeholders. Youll primarily focus on private development client projects.

Company Profile More about us:
Founded in 1970 R.J. Burnside & Associates Limited is a growing valuesdriven employeeowned multidiscipline engineering and environmental consulting firm with over 400 staff. Our consistent commitment towards investing in technology advancements and training in addition to encouraging and promoting professional development has enabled our firm to meet our ongoing and stated goal of continual improvement.
We actively seek to develop relationships with a broad and diversified client base in the Public Private Indigenous and International sectors.We work on a variety of projects throughout Canada with ten office locations in Ontario and one in Manitoba.
Burnside has expertise in many technical disciplines including air and noise asset management buildings environmental planning and ecology GIS hydrogeology land development landscape architecture municipal drainage and peer review solid waste stormwater management structures transportation planning and design transit water and wastewater and well drilling & diagnostics.
